你查询的IP:[122.8.95.53]  地理位置:中国–上海–上海

最新查询59.191.1.22 124.42.1.60 116.244.0.5 117.58.9.83 117.60.9.88 203.92.113.71 125.62.6.22 222.16.0.36 59.64.87.13 122.8.95.53 114.60.133.160 221.130.181.64 120.24.185.144 116.224.182.207 203.100.80.75 202.41.240.252 58.16.250.161 117.120.128.255 61.4.80.183 117.100.112.201 203.190.96.57 219.72.219.72 121.101.208.75 121.59.33.159 124.67.7.170 221.13.179.214 202.91.128.50 118.132.80.25 202.90.252.125 119.96.92.24 124.200.38.111